Output 0d24613ae3b3d10cc6617472a17a17dc8c530f60e0334ccba0eeff98bcb0e98e:1

value
22000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8654f083814003804a2a163d48818262a32ca281 OP_EQUALVERIFY OP_CHECKSIG
address
1DFHJQXdvaibtsJzumY4LMPGk4a6YTtSCz
transaction
0d24613ae3b3d10cc6617472a17a17dc8c530f60e0334ccba0eeff98bcb0e98e
spent
true